solve the right triangle. round decimal answers to the nearest tenth.
triangle image with right angle at s, angle at r is 57°, side st is 15, rs ≈ 9.7, m∠t = 33°, rt ≈ □
Step1: Confirm right triangle angles
Sum of angles in triangle is $180^\circ$.
$m\angle T = 180^\circ - 90^\circ - 57^\circ = 33^\circ$
Step2: Calculate hypotenuse $RT$
Use cosine of $\angle R$: $\cos(57^\circ)=\frac{RS}{RT}$ is given, use $\tan(57^\circ)=\frac{ST}{RS}$ to verify $RS$, then use Pythagoras: $RT=\sqrt{RS^2 + ST^2}$
$RS\approx9.7$, $ST=15$, so $RT=\sqrt{9.7^2 + 15^2}=\sqrt{94.09 + 225}=\sqrt{319.09}\approx17.9$
